Tori mean the shrine of God.<img id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5112523738269865282" style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N: 0px auto 10px; WIDTH: 130px; CURSOR: hand; HEIGHT: 127px; TEXT-ALIGN: center" height="62" alt=""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EiPRul2KKjGnmHtJt7QlgFUfRAfPd5iRdBXH0TkC7IIuoOc6jOzr6OPpuGVNG6F3Lmd09FzKN3FkJgNjdMlCepgVMyOvUe91lHE0BTa2783qvM0kClFpgwHEeeWi5fZSjyyl5bHsVKbKBX-/s320/images.jpg" width="125" border="0" /><br /><br /><br /></span><div><span style="font-family:lucida grande;"><span style="color:#ffffff;">Shinto, in Japanese means the way of the gods, Japanese cult and religion, was originating in prehistoric times, and dwell in an important national position for long periods in the history of Japan, even in recent times. During its early period, the body of </span><a href="http://images.google.co.id/imgres?imgurl=http://www.isymbolz.com/spiritual/shinto/sh004-shinto-04-sm.jpg&imgrefurl=http://www.isymbolz.com/spiritual/shinto/index.htm&h=65&w=72&sz=5&hl=en&start=4&um=1&tbnid=H3c7c2Btyw6MZM:&tbnh=62&tbnw=69&prev=/images%3Fq%3Dshinto%2Bsymbol%26svnum%3D10%26um%3D1%26hl%3Den%26sa%3DN"></a><span style="color:#ffffff;">religious belief and practice called Shinto was without a name and had no fixed dogma, moral precepts, or sacred writings. Worship centered on a vast pantheon of spirits, or kami, mainly divinities personifying aspects of the natural world, such as the sky, the earth, heavenly bodies, and storms. Rites included prayers of thanksgiving; offerings of valuables, such as weapons and armor and, especially, cloth; and purification from crime and ruining.</span></span></div><br /><br /><div><span style="font-family:lucida grande;"><br /><span style="color:#ffffff;">In the late 6th century ad the name Shinto was created for the native religion to differentiate it from Buddhism and Confucianism, which had been introduced from China. Shinto was rapidly overshadowed by Buddhism, and the native gods were generally regarded as manifestations of Buddha in a previous state of existence.<br />Buddhist priests became the guardians of Shinto shrines and introduced their own ornaments, images, and ritual. At the end of the 8th and the beginning of the 9th centuries, the celebrated Japanese teacher Kūkai, or (posthumously) Kobo Daishi, established a doctrine uniting Buddhism and Shinto under the name of Ryobu Shinto (Japanese, “the Shinto of two kinds”). </span></span></div><br /><br /><div><span style="color:#ffffff;"></span></div><br /><br /><div><span style="font-family:lucida grande;color:#ffffff;">In the new religion, Buddhism dominated Shinto, and elements were adopted from Confucianism. The ancient practice of Shinto proper close to disappeared and was maintained only at a few great shrines and in the imperial palace, although the emperors themselves had become Buddhists. The typically Shinto priests became fortune-tellers and magicians.<br />Beginning in the 18th century, Shinto was recharged as an important national religion through the writings and teachings of a succession of notable scholars, including Mabuchi, Motoori Norinaga, and Hirata Atsutane. Motivated by nationalistic sentiments that took the form of reverence for Japanese antiquity and hatred for ideas and practices of foreign origin, these men prepared the way for the disestablishment of Buddhism and the adoption of Shinto as the state religion. In 1867 the shogunate was defeated, and the emperor was restored to the head of the government. According to revived Shinto doctrine, the sovereignty of the emperor was exercised by divine right through his reputed descent from the sun goddess Amaterasu Omikami, who is considered the founder of the Japanese nation. </span></div><br /><br /><div><span style="font-family:lucida grande;color:#ffffff;"></span></div><br /><br /><div><span style="font-family:lucida grande;color:#ffffff;">Related beliefs included the doctrines that the Japanese were superior to other peoples because of their descent from the gods, and that the emperor was destined to rule over the entire world. Until the defeat of Japan in World War II, these beliefs were of the extreme importance in assuring popular support for the military expansion of the Japanese Empire.</span></div><div><span style="font-family:lucida grande;color:#ffffff;"></span></div><div><span style="font-family:lucida grande;"><a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Shinto"><span style="color:#ffffff;">http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Shinto</span></a><span style="color:#ffffff;"> open at 19 September</span></span></div><div><a href="http://jinja.jp/english/s-0.html"><span style="color:#ffffff;">http://jinja.jp/english/s-0.html</span></a><span style="color:#ffffff;"> open at 20 September</span></div><div><a href="http://www.faithintowerhamlets.com/default/1100.guide/guides/shinto.html"><span style="color:#ffffff;">http://www.faithintowerhamlets.com/default/1100.guide/guides/shinto.html</span></a><span style="color:#ffffff;"> open at September 20</span></div><div><span style="color:#ffffff;"></span></div></div></div><span style="color:#ffffff;">http://www.religioustolerance.org/shinto.html open at 20 September</span>devilbatshttp://www.blogger.com/profile/09440831345131628759noreply@blogger.com3t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-2512973650261528186.post-7471618114440296722007-09-19T20:46:00.000-07:002007-09-19T21:15:13.219-07:00Beatrix potter<a href="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Ej3fkGSUhCca2i4Fr8Wtuf_eWeKx_MvLp1Dox895Qt7X2kxum4a_dEr7wKtuE5m3kZGy9nS4uJ23qJ2Hg2ioqPgXZ_2gzwNcqXLWNoNurC6d-XvjUeBwu7bHxGh8Y2HJSHBKmm3irqRid-m/s1600-h/3791858239.jpg"><img id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5112134609628392274" style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N: 0px auto 10px; CURSOR: hand; TEXT-ALIGN: center" alt="" src="https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Ej3fkGSUhCca2i4Fr8Wtuf_eWeKx_MvLp1Dox895Qt7X2kxum4a_dEr7wKtuE5m3kZGy9nS4uJ23qJ2Hg2ioqPgXZ_2gzwNcqXLWNoNurC6d-XvjUeBwu7bHxGh8Y2HJSHBKmm3irqRid-m/s400/3791858239.jpg" border="0" /></a><br /><div>Is your imagination deep? I know why he eats me because he has to give something important to his body.<br />Anyways, what is digestion? Digestion is the breaking down of food into forms that human bodies can use. The bodies use food as fuel to provide energy for work, play and growth. The digestive system is responsible for converting the foods that human eat into energy for bodies to use. <br /><br />Mouth<br />Ouch!!! I am bitten off by his teeth. I am in his mouth and he starts chewing me now. The digestion begins by breaking down of food into small molecules. The teeth help to break the food apart, saliva helps to soften the food and his tongue helps to push the food into his throat when he ready to swallow. It means I am in the mechanical breakdown, plus some chemical (because it uses ptyalin, enzyme in saliva).<br /><br />Swallowing<br />After being chewed, food is forced into the rest of the digestive tract by swallowing me. The tongue and the floor of the mouth rise, squeezing food into a muscular tube called the esophagus. I slide down the esophagus with the help of mucle contraction, peristalsis. Peristalsis is the name given to the wave-like contraction. If human tries to talk while swallowing food may enter the respiratory passages and a cough reflex expels.<br /><br />Stomach<br />After moving through the 25 cm length of the esophagus, the bites of me reach the stomach. It is J- shaped bag, left side, just below the heart. Here, I temporarily stored. The principal activity is to begin the digestion of protein. The stomach makes digestive juices (acids and enzymes) that help to break me down into a thick liquid or paste. This thick liquid or paste is called chyme. The stomach is a muscular organ that is able to move in order to mix the food with digestive juices. I remain in the stomach for about two hours. <br /><br />The small intestine<br />After leaving the stomach the piece of me enters the small intestine. It is a 20-25 foot tube that is coiled up in human abdomen. The most important part of digestion takes place in the small intestine. As the thick liquid food paste travels through small intestine, the nutrients (vitamins, minerals, proteins, carbohydrates and fats) are absorbed by millions of tiny finger-like objects called villi and sent into bloodstream where the nutrients can travel to all the body cells. The liver and gallbladder help digest fats in foods. Liver also helps body store extra food that it cannot use right away. Pancreas creates the chemical insulin to help body use sugar. There†are†some†leftovers that get to the end of small intestine. The leftovers go into your large intestine.<br /><br />Large Intestine<br />The undigested food enters the large intestine as a liquid paste. In the large intestine water is removed from the liquid paste turning what is left into solid waste. The solid waste then collects in the rectum at the end of the large intestine and will finally leave the body through an opening called the anus.<br /><br /><em>The Fact</em><br /><br />1.
